Overview
This trip is a 14-day journey through Peru’s rich cultural and natural heritage. Starting in Lima with a visit to the renowned Larco Museum, the journey continues to Ica and Paracas for coastal adventures. In Arequipa, explore its volcanic landscapes and the stunning Colca Canyon, with opportunities to observe Andean wildlife and ancient ruins. From the Sacred Valley and Machu Picchu to the high-altitude beauty of Lake Titicaca, this tour combines immersive cultural experiences, breathtaking scenery, and the mystical allure of Peru's southern treasures. What you will be doing
Upon your arrival in Lima, begin your journey with a visit to the renowned Larco Museum, where you can admire an exceptional collection of pre-Columbian art and artefacts. In the evening, we'll have dinner at one of Lima's top-rated restaurants, offering a taste of the city's vibrant culinary scene.
Travel to the Paracas region and embark on a boat trip to the Ballestas Islands, where you'll encounter an array of wildlife. Later, visit the stunning oasis of Huacachina, nestled amidst towering sand dunes, and explore the scenic Pisco Route.
Arrive in Arequipa and take a guided tour of the city's historic centre, including the Plaza de Armas and the impressive Santa Catalina Monastery, a colourful architectural gem.
Journey towards Colca Canyon, passing the majestic Chachani and Misti volcanoes. Explore the Salinas and Aguada Blanca National Reserve, home to herds of vicuñas, llamas, and alpacas. Visit the picturesque villages of Callalli, Sibayo, and Tuti to immerse yourself in the local culture.
Explore more of the Colca region with visits to the charming villages of Maca and Pinchollo. Stop at the Cruz del Condor and Tapay viewpoints for breathtaking views of the canyon and condors soaring overhead. Discover the village of Yanque and hike to the pre-Inca ruins of Uyu Uyu.
Before returning to Arequipa, visit the Achoma community, where you can learn about traditional Andean customs. Afterwards, transfer back to Arequipa for an evening at leisure. Fly from Arequipa to Cusco, then continue your journey to the Sacred Valley. Along the way, stop at the village of Pisac, known for its vibrant market and Inca ruins.
Explore the Sacred Valley's highlights, including the Maras salt mines, the Inca agricultural terraces of Moray, and the traditional Misminay community. Visit the Inca fortress of Ollantaytambo, then board a scenic train ride through the Urubamba Valley, arriving in the town of Machu Picchu.
Begin your day with a zigzag bus ride to Machu Picchu, the iconic Lost City of the Incas. Enjoy a guided tour of this world-famous archaeological site before returning to Cusco.
Board the luxurious Andean Explorer train for a scenic journey from Cusco to Puno, crossing the beautiful Andean highlands. Upon arrival in Puno, transfer to your hotel and unwind for the evening.
Embark on a boat trip to the Uros floating reed islands, where you'll discover the unique way of life of the Uros people. Continue to Amantani Island for a cultural experience, exploring local homes and visiting the ancient Pachamama and Pachatata temples.
Hike across Amantani Island, observing local traditions and enjoying panoramic views. You'll have the opportunity to purchase handmade textiles, stonework, and other artisanal crafts. Return to Puno for an evening at leisure.
After breakfast, transfer to Juliaca and catch your flight back to Lima. Enjoy some free time in the capital city or use this opportunity to explore more of Lima's historical and cultural offerings.
